diff options
author | Ittay Stern <ittay.stern@att.com> | 2019-07-30 12:27:40 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@onap.org> | 2019-07-30 12:27:40 +0000 |
commit | 43e9904b232c1c957857da534cd5605aa9984db3 (patch) | |
tree | 93d5ecbe339ba70e987337f8af5c4a1474936789 /epsdk-app-onap | |
parent | d39964940a6fecbd86007327e6026dda73f7ac18 (diff) | |
parent | 1a53b6bf5ab268e7a92d90ee9fe812d8835e7490 (diff) |
Merge "Add app version to welcome page"
Diffstat (limited to 'epsdk-app-onap')
-rw-r--r-- | epsdk-app-onap/src/main/webapp/WEB-INF/fusion/jsp/ebz/ebz_header.jsp | 36 |
1 files changed, 34 insertions, 2 deletions
diff --git a/epsdk-app-onap/src/main/webapp/WEB-INF/fusion/jsp/ebz/ebz_header.jsp b/epsdk-app-onap/src/main/webapp/WEB-INF/fusion/jsp/ebz/ebz_header.jsp index 44fe53a88..4808ccd43 100644 --- a/epsdk-app-onap/src/main/webapp/WEB-INF/fusion/jsp/ebz/ebz_header.jsp +++ b/epsdk-app-onap/src/main/webapp/WEB-INF/fusion/jsp/ebz/ebz_header.jsp @@ -246,6 +246,7 @@ <a ng-click="toggleDrawer();isOpen = !isOpen" href="javascript:void(0);" class="arrow-icon-left" > <span class="icon-hamburger"></span></a> <span ng-init="isOpen = true" ng-show="isOpen" style="font-size:16px; position:relative; top:-8px; left:-15px;">    {{app_name}}</span> + <span data-tests-id='app-version' ng-show="isOpen" style="font-size:13px; position:relative; top:15px; left:-45px; color:#666666;">{{app_version}}</span> </span> <div att-drawer drawer-slide="left" drawer-custom-top="{{drawer_custom_top}}px" drawer-size="200px" drawer-open="drawerOpen" drawer-custom-height="100%" > <div ng-style="adjustHLeftMenu('leftMenu')"> @@ -313,6 +314,7 @@ fullName:'', email:'' } + $scope.app_version=""; /*Put user info into fields*/ $scope.inputUserInfo = function(userInfo){ if (typeof(userInfo) != "undefined" && userInfo!=null && userInfo!=''){ @@ -388,7 +390,21 @@ } ]; return megaMenuDataObjectTemp; - }; + }; + + var getAppVersion = function() { + return $http.get('version') + .then(function(response) { + if (typeof response.data === 'object') { + return response.data; + } else { + return $q.reject(response.data); + } + }, function(response) { + // something went wrong + return $q.reject(response.data); + }); + } /*Left Menu*/ @@ -425,7 +441,23 @@ console.log('getAppName failed', error); }); - + getAppVersion().then(function(response){ + var j = response; + try{ + if(j){ + $scope.app_version = j.displayVersion; + + }else{ + throw "Version response is not in expected format."; + } + }catch (e) { + console.log("Error happened while trying to get app version: "+e); + return; + } + },function(error){ + console.log('getAppVersion failed', error); + }); + $scope.getTopMenuStaticInfo(); $scope.getMenu=function() { |